Hard drive has disappeared.

My computer crashed one day and when I booted it back up my secondary hard drive had disappeared from My Computer but when I go into the bios it is recognized. I tried right clicking on My Computer and going to Manage because that is how I had to get Windows to see the HDD when I installed it but it doesn't show up there either. I ran two virus scans and found nothing. Any idea on how to get this HDD to show up again without formatting? I have a lot of files on that drive I don't want to lose. Thanks.

Re: Hard drive has disappeared.

check the plug has not come loose from the back of the drive
try a new cable you may have a broken wire
check disk management
